Observation of the helicity-selection-rule suppressed decay of the $\chi_{c2}$ charmonium state

TL;DR
This study measures specific decay modes of the $oldsymbol{ ext{chi}}_{c2}$ charmonium state, revealing significant violations of the helicity selection rule and U-spin symmetry breaking in charmonium decays for the first time.
Contribution
It provides the first measurements of certain $oldsymbol{ ext{chi}}_{c2}$ decay branching fractions and demonstrates strong helicity rule violation and U-spin symmetry breaking effects.
Findings
Branching fractions of $oldsymbol{ ext{chi}}_{c2}$ decays to $K^{ ext{*}}ar{K}$ measured for the first time.
Significant violation of the helicity selection rule observed in $oldsymbol{ ext{chi}}_{c2}$ decays.
Large difference in decay rates indicating U-spin symmetry breaking.
